Vous êtes sur la page 1sur 3

Bonjour à tous, j'espère que vous allez bien. Bienvenue à notre présentation.

Aujourd'hui, nous allons parler de l'une des cartes les plus importantes dans le
domaine des systèmes embarqués, qui est la carte Arduino. Cette carte est largement
utilisée de nos jours pour différentes applications et est considérée comme essentielle
dans le prototypage.

Ainsi, la présentation sera divisée en 9 parties, comme indiqué.

Un système embarqué est un ensemble informatique dédié à une tâche spécifique. Intégré
dans des dispositifs variés, il opère en temps réel, souvent avec des ressources limitées. Son
design compact, sa faible consommation d'énergie et sa spécialisation en font l'outil idéal
pour des applications allant des appareils électroniques grand public aux dispositifs
industriels

La carte Arduino joue un rôle crucial dans les systèmes embarqués en tant que
plateforme de développement flexible et accessible. Voici quelques-uns des rôles clés
de la carte Arduino dans un système embarqué :

1. Prototypage Rapide : Arduino facilite le prototypage rapide en offrant une


interface conviviale pour le développement matériel. Les concepteurs peuvent
rapidement tester et itérer des idées sans avoir besoin d'une expertise
approfondie en électronique.
2. Simplicité d'Utilisation : Grâce à son environnement de développement
intégré (IDE) convivial, Arduino rend la programmation des microcontrôleurs
plus accessible, même pour ceux qui n'ont pas une expérience approfondie en
programmation.
3. Compatibilité Matérielle : Arduino est compatible avec une gamme étendue
de capteurs, modules, et périphériques, simplifiant l'intégration de composants
dans un projet embarqué.
4. Communauté Active : La communauté Arduino est vaste et dynamique. Les
utilisateurs peuvent partager des codes, des projets et des idées, facilitant
l'apprentissage et l'innovation dans le domaine des systèmes embarqués.
5. Éducation : Arduino est largement utilisé dans des programmes éducatifs
pour enseigner les bases de l'électronique et de la programmation. Cela
contribue à former la prochaine génération d'ingénieurs et de développeurs
dans le domaine des systèmes embarqués.
6. Adaptabilité : La modularité de la carte Arduino permet aux développeurs de
personnaliser leur matériel en fonction des besoins spécifiques de leur projet,
offrant ainsi une solution adaptable à diverses applications embarquées.
Qu'est-ce qu'une carte Arduino ?

la carte Arduino est une plateforme open-source de prototypage électronique équipée d'un
microcontrôleur. Facile à utiliser, elle offre un environnement de développement convivial,
permettant aux amateurs et aux professionnels de créer rapidement des projets
électroniques. Les cartes Arduino sont polyvalentes, adaptées à diverses applications, de la
robotique à l'Internet des objets (IoT), et sont largement utilisées dans l'éducation et le
prototypage rapide.

ideee
Ce que j'aime le plus dans l'ensemble de ce projet et la raison pour laquelle nous avons choisi
ce sujet à discuter, c'est l'idée de l'invention de cette carte. Puisqu'il s'agissait d'un projet de
fin d'études réalisé par 5 étudiants qui ont créé une carte de circuit imprimé (PCB) pour leur
projet de dernière année. L'idée a attiré l'attention de leurs superviseurs qui les ont aidés à la
développer davantage. Aujourd'hui, Arduino est l'une des plus grandes et importantes
entreprises de l'industrie, avec une valeur nette de 56,1 millions de dollars américains.

fonction

La magie de la carte Arduino réside dans sa simplicité d'utilisation et son potentiel


d'innovation. Jetons un coup d'œil au fonctionnement essentiel de cette plateforme de
prototypage électronique.

la carte offre une plateforme accessible, puissante et polyvalente, transformant les idées
créatives en projets électroniques concrets. C'est l'outil idéal pour les novices et les experts,
stimulant l'innovation dans le monde de l'électronique.

Applications de la Carte Arduino : L'Électronique au Service de l'Innovation

La carte Arduino ne se contente pas d'être une simple plateforme de prototypage,


elle s'est épanouie dans une multitude d'applications qui repoussent les limites de
l'électronique créative. Jetons un regard sur quelques-unes de ses applications
captivantes

Domotique Intelligente : Arduino alimente la révolution de la domotique, permettant la


création de systèmes intelligents de contrôle d'éclairage, de chauffage, et de sécurité pour
rendre nos maisons plus connectées que jamais

Robotique Éducative : Les salles de classe du monde entier intègrent Arduino dans des
projets éducatifs de robotique, enseignant aux étudiants les bases de la programmation et de
la conception de robots.

ioT et Connectivité : Arduino est au cœur de nombreux projets de l'Internet des Objets (IoT),
permettant la création d'appareils connectés et de systèmes intelligents
programmation

La programmation de la carte Arduino est la clé qui ouvre la porte à un monde


d'innovation électronique. Plongeons dans le processus fascinant qui permet de
donner vie à vos idées.

1. Environnement de Développement Convivial : L'Arduino IDE offre une


interface conviviale, même pour ceux qui découvrent la programmation. Un
éditeur de code simple et des outils de débogage rendent le processus
accessible à tous.
2. Langage Simplifié : Le langage de programmation Arduino est basé sur C/C+
+, mais simplifié pour faciliter la compréhension.
3. Structure du Code : Un programme Arduino est composé de deux fonctions
principales : setup() et loop(). La fonction setup() est exécutée une fois au
démarrage, tandis que la fonction loop() s'exécute en boucle, traitant
continuellement les instructions.
4. Librairies et Modules : Arduino propose une variété de bibliothèques pré-
écrites pour simplifier la programmation de tâches courantes. Des modules
complémentaires peuvent également être ajoutés pour étendre les
fonctionnalités.
5. Téléversement du Code : Une fois le code écrit, il est téléversé sur la carte
Arduino via un simple câble USB. Cela permet au microcontrôleur de
comprendre et d'exécuter les instructions.
.
projet

La polyvalence de la carte Arduino a inspiré une multitude de projets innovants à travers le


monde. Voici quelques exemples concrets qui illustrent le potentiel créatif de cette
plateforme.

Vous aimerez peut-être aussi